Abstract
PROCEDIMIENTO Y DISPOSITIVO PARA EL ENDURECIMIENTO POR INDUCCION DE SUPERFICIES ONDULADAS DE UNAS PIEZAS DE HERRAMIENTA COMO EL ENGRANAJE DE UNAS RUEDAS DE ENGRANAJE O DE CADENA. SE CONSIGUE UNA FORMACION DE DUREZA DISTRIBUIDA SIMILARMENTE POR EL ENGRANAJE Y CONTROLADA PROFUNDAMENTE, YA QUE LA SUPERFICIE DE LA PIEZA DE HERRAMIENTA A ENDURECERSE SE EXPLORA POR LA BOBINA (12) DE CALENTAMIENTO POR INDUCCION, MIENTRAS LA PIEZA HERRAMIENTA SE HACE PASAR POR LA BOBINA (12) DE CALENTAMIENTO POR INDUCCION. SE CARACTERIZA EL PROCEDIMIENTO PORQUE UN CALENTAMIENTO FINAL EXPLORANDO LA PIEZA HERRAMIENTA OBEDECE A UN CALENTAMIENTO PREVIO EXPLORANDO LA PIEZA HERRAMIENTA POR LO QUE PUEDEN REALIZARSE LOS CALENTAMIENTOS PREVIO Y FINAL CON VELOCIDADES CONTROLADAS Y DIFERENTES. LA EXPLORACION REPETIDA DE LAS HERRAMIENTAS (W) POR UNA BOBINA (12) INDUCTIVA PERMITE EL CALENTAMIENTO PREVIO Y EL CALENTAMIENTO FINAL DE LA PIEZA HERRAMIENTA QUE NO PUEDE REALIZARSE DE FORMA INMEDIATA Y EN DIRECCION AXIAL POR BOBINAS INDUCTORAS SEPARADAS COMO ES EL CASO DE RUEDAS DE ENGRANAJES PLANETARIAS CON ANILLO INFERIOR QUE PRESENTA UN EXTREMO (12) CERRADO O COMO ES EL CASO DE RUEDAS DENTADAS EN ESTRELLA QUE PRESENTAN UN ESCALON SALIENTE RADIAL O UN FLANCO SALIENTE POR EL DENTADO CILINDRICO.
